"A countryside accommodation and vineyard property set on 26 acres that offers private cabins and houses, plus an on-site bistro and wine bar, enabling immersive stays that combine lodging with access to wine tastings and vineyard scenery. The pastoral setting is suited for guests seeking a slower, vineyard-centered getaway." - Amanda Ogle Amanda Ogle Amanda Ogle is a writer and editor who specializes in travel, food and drink, sustainability, and general lifestyle topics. We are both employees for a major airline (Pilot and Flight Attendant) and have had the opportunity to travel the world over and spend most of our lives staying in some really nice places but from minute one we were both taken aback at the beauty and attention to detail that Daniel and Deborah have given this place. Staying at Barons Creekside was a last minute decision to escape from our airport life and find some peace and quiet. We found that and more during our 5 day stay. From the minute we arrived, the simplicity of the check-in process ( Just pick your keys up from the mailbox at The Club ), to having precut firewood available right by the cabin impressed us. The combination of amazing log cabins, outdoor fire pits and charcoal BBQ's, all nestled together on gently rolling terrain with a subtle but much appreciated hint of privacy, showed us we had selected the perfect getaway. The ability to just enjoy a quiet evening on the patio or join in the fun at The Club located on the property was the icing on the cake. Also, the proximity to downtown Fredericksburg, as well as over 70 Vineyards, Peach Harvesting, and Horseback Riding put the stay over the top. We had an amazing vineyard tour of Kuhlman's Winery one day and a relaxing 2 hour trail ride at the Blue Moon Ranch the next evening. Highly recommend both of these adventures. We even worked in a quick afternoon trip to Luckenbach TX (home of Texas Country Music). Evenings brought some amazing live music at The Club as well as some excellent wines right from the vineyard located on the property. Lastly, the amazing staff that Daniel and Deborah have put together shows what incredible people they are!! Their staff never missed a beat. Believe us when we say, this is a hidden gem in the Texas Hill Country you will want to come back to again and again. We will !!!!

I want to thank Daniel, Deborah and Simon for their incredible work on maintaining a true "getaway" from the fast pace of life. Barons CreekSide was inspired by Daniel's roots in Switzerland. He has traveled to over 200 countries and found that Fredericksburg, TX was an excellent spot to buy a plot of land and create this safe haven. Conveniently located a few minutes from downtown, it's right off the reservation to where you can enjoy nature and more importantly the amazing cabins he and his team created.
